Just wondering if the port size on the inlet manifold of a g13a is the same as on a g16a?
I know there is a difference on it where the carby bolts up re water jacket but not sure of ports.
I have a g16a in my Sierra now and a spare g13a manifold in the garage that I want to do some mods on and install a weber, but not sure on the port sizes being the same.

from memory its a 1mm difference i think the sierra manifold is better as the 4 intake runners are even length using epoxy putty i added certain features that the g16a intake had to the sierra one
smaller chamber below carb with less dead zones, sort of like an internal throttle plate spacer. Done it to two intakes. Held up the for the last 5 years.
